UniverCell in expansion mode
Corporate Reporter
CHENNAI:
UniverCell, a retail chain engaged in selling mobile phones, accessories and providing mobile connections, is in the final stages of negotiations with strategic investors keen on making investments in the company. It has also charted an ambitious growth plan and is looking at a pan-India presence over the next three years.
D. Sathish Babu, Managing Director, UniverCell, told this correspondent that "We are looking at Rs. 50-60 crore through strategic investments and it will materialise soon."
UniverCell at present has eight outlets in Chennai. Mr. Sathish said the company was looking at opening 20 outlets before March 2007 in Tamil Nadu alone. It would open 300 outlets across the country by 2009.
The company reported a revenue of Rs. 72 crore in 2005-06 and targeted a turnover of Rs. 150 crore in the current financial year.
